Gold-Backed Cryptocurrencies

Gold-Backed Cryptocurrencies

A cryptocurrency is a digital or virtual currency that uses cryptography for security and operates on a decentralized network called a blockchain. This decentralized nature means that cryptocurrencies are not controlled by a central authority like a government or financial institution. Instead, they rely on a network of computers to verify and record transactions. Some of the most popular cryptocurrencies include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in.

About

Alpha Bullion is an innovative service for redeeming PAX Gold tokens for real, physical gold. Each token acts as proof of ownership for 1 oz of gold stored at no additional cost in bar form in some of the most secure vaults in London. This provides all the stability benefits offered by precious metals without the burden of storage or shipping. It also allows for a market first feature, as the potential for cryptocurrency loans using PAX Gold would allow customers to essentially earn dividends on precious metals.
